Penske Automotive Group, Inc. (NYSE:PAG - Free Report) - Seaport Res Ptn increased their Q3 2025 EPS estimates for shares of Penske Automotive Group in a report released on Monday, August 11th. Seaport Res Ptn analyst G. Chin now anticipates that the company will post earnings per share of $3.59 for the quarter, up from their previous forecast of $3.55. The consensus estimate for Penske Automotive Group's current full-year earnings is $13.86 per share. Seaport Res Ptn also issued estimates for Penske Automotive Group's FY2025 earnings at $14.14 EPS and FY2026 earnings at $13.82 EPS.

Penske Automotive Group (NYSE:PAG -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Wednesday, July 30th. The company reported $3.78 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$3.56 by $0.22. The company had revenue of $7.66 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$7.98 billion. Penske Automotive Group had a net margin of 3.13% and a return on equity of 17.43%. The company's revenue was down .4%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the firm posted $3.61 earnings per share.

Penske Automotive Group Increases Dividend

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, September 3rd. Stockholders of record on Friday, August 15th will be paid a $1.32 dividend. This represents a $5.28 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 2.9%. The ex-dividend date is Friday, August 15th. This is an increase from Penske Automotive Group's previous quarterly dividend of $1.26. Penske Automotive Group's dividend payout ratio is 36.74%.

Penske Automotive Group declared that its Board of Directors has authorized a share buyback program on Wednesday, May 14th that authorizes the company to repurchase $250.00 million in outstanding shares. This repurchase authorization authorizes the company to purchase up to 2.3% of its shares through open market purchases. Shares repurchase programs are often a sign that the company's board believes its shares are undervalued.

About Penske Automotive Group

(Get Free Report)

Penske Automotive Group, Inc, a diversified transportation services company, operates automotive and commercial truck dealerships worldwide. The company operates through four segments: Retail Automotive, Retail Commercial Truck, Other, and Non-Automotive Investments. It operates dealerships under franchise agreements with various automotive manufacturers and distributors.
